Going to a Foreign Country It is always difficult for one to go to a foreign land and spend time away from family and friends. But then again there are some decisions in life which require sacrifice of the highest order. If I ever go abroad to pursue higher education, I would face difficulty in the beginning coping up with the norms and behaviors of the society in which I have stepped into as well as dearly miss my friends and family members. However I realize that this is a short phase which would occur mostly in the starting and with things settling down, I will feel all at ease within the foreign country.

In the pursuit of knowledge, I am ready to undertake such a visit to a foreign country but I know this beforehand that I would come back to serve my own motherland so that my country benefits from my education and related experience that I have gained in the foreign country. I have made it a point to dedicate myself whole-heartedly towards studies once I land in the foreign country. I would not indulge in acts which are unbecoming of a student and devote all my energies towards something constructive.

I would find ways to interact with my peers and ask them for their help if ever I drop into some problem. I will proactively help my mates without their even asking for the same. I would make a schedule for myself so that I could study within my free time and also understand a little about the culture of the foreign country. I would communicate with people in their own language so that they feel I am a part of them and am willing to make an effort to be close to them through their language. This will give them a feeling of love and humbleness from my side.

I believe being away from all of these people would eventually help me focus more on my studies as well as impart quality time towards the curriculum. I would try my best to attain the top position within my class. I will regularly keep in touch with my family members and once in a while meet my friends of the past online. I will keep them abreast of my educational journey as well as find out what is happening within their own lives. I would make an effort to wish my friends and family members on special occasions which I will surely be missing the most.

I would call them up on their birthdays, wedding anniversaries and so on and thus try to be a part of their happy and grief-stricken moments. In the end, I would like to tell them how much I love them by sending them gifts and cards from the foreign country since I believe this is the most beautiful gesture that I can undertake sitting miles away. I would try my best to remain loyal, committed and truthful towards my education and keep my parents proud of my achievements. Word Count: 508
